NOTICE OF PUBLIC HEARING
The City Council of the City of Cape Ca-
naveral, Florida will hold a Public Hearing
for the purpose of discussing Ordinance No.
17-2012 in the Cape Canaveral Library
Meeting Room, 201 Polk Avenue, Cape Ca-
naveral, Florida at 6 P.M., on Tuesday, Oc-
tober 16, 2012. The Ordinance may be in-
spected in its entirety in the City Clerk's of-
fice during business hours (8:30 a.m. to 5:00
P.m., Monday -Friday).
ORDINANCE 17-2012
An Ordinance of the City Council of the City
of Cape Canaveral, Brevard County, Flori-
da, amending Chapter 38, Fire Prevention
and Protection, of the Cape Canaveral Code
of Ordinances related to Public Fire Protec-
tion Service Charges; providing for the re-
peal of prior inconsistent ordinances and
resolutions; incorporation into the Code;
severability; and an effective date
